☆ Be the first to review + Add to your collection — Join freeIn "The Troopship Terror," Capt. Shaw survives a harrowing plane crash on a remote island during a wartime dogfight, only to find himself hunted by Japanese soldiers. Rescued by the mysterious Agent 206, the two must navigate the island’s dangers and evade capture to return to the fleet. Written and illustrated by Bob Powell, with a striking cover by Gill Fox, this 1942 adventure blends wartime tension and covert action in a gripping wartime tale.

Capt. Shaw's plane is shot down during a dogfight and he is forced to make an emergency landing on an island. On the island, he is rescued from Japanese soldiers by Agent 206 and together they make their way back to the fleet.
